全国计算机等级考试二级C语言详解:从入门到实战
需积分: 10 95 浏览量
更新于2024-07-18
收藏 1.3MB PPT 举报
全国计算机等级考试(NCRE)中的二级考试,特别是针对C语言,是IT技能认证的重要环节。NCRE分为四个等级,二级主要考察C语言的基础和应用能力,包括但不限于以下几个方面:
1. 考试内容与形式:
- 时间安排:每年上半年3月倒数第一个周六和下半年9月倒数第二个周六举行笔试和上机考试。
- 笔试部分:主要考察C语言知识,包括选择题和填空题,其中C语言题目占比70%,公共基础知识占30%。
- 上机考试:包含填空、改错和编程题目,这些实践性强的题目旨在检验考生的实际编程能力和问题解决能力。
2. C语言基础:
- 简单程序示例:如两数求和和计算矩形面积的程序,展示了基本的数据类型、变量声明、算术运算符以及输出格式控制。
- 程序流程:强调了主函数的重要性,一个程序只能有一个main函数,程序执行从main开始,变量需先定义后使用,语句结尾必须有分号,注释使用方式和格式规范。
3. 程序生命周期:
- 编程过程:从C源代码到可执行文件的过程,包括编译、链接和运行,分别对应源文件(.c或.cpp),目标文件(.obj),以及最终的可执行文件(.exe)。
4. 程序设计基础:
- 注重程序结构,指出程序由语句组成,主函数的必要性,以及注释的使用规则,如多行注释和格式自由度。
5. 算法概念:
- 算法被定义为解决问题的一系列方法和步骤,它是程序设计的核心,二级C语言考试可能涉及算法设计和分析的基本概念。
通过二级C语言考试,考生将具备扎实的C语言编程基础,理解程序结构,掌握基本数据类型、运算、控制结构等,并能运用所学知识解决实际问题。这不仅对求职者来说是一项加分项,也是进一步学习高级语言和技术的基础。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2010-05-05 上传
2011-05-08 上传
2011-07-15 上传
2011-02-25 上传
2010-08-10 上传
qq_35678759
- 粉丝: 0
- 资源: 3
最新资源
- HDS:家居设计解决方案API
- QT单例模式,点击控件显示一次界面
- website:Codechef-SGGS-章节网站
- BLayers:Razor组件和OpenLayers JavaScript互操作
- Gabor 函数:生成二维空间 Gabor 函数。 用于生成模型简单的细胞感受野。-matlab开发
- set border body for some websites-crx插件
- 冲绳
- test softwaretest softwaretest softwaretest software
- C++网络编程编译好的Libcurl库c++ include文件和libcurl.lib下载后直接用
- build-your-own-vuex:精简vuex源代码,用最少的代码实现一个可以快速阅读的精简版vuex(预期总代码行数不超过100行)
- tvmm:Tiny Virtual Machine Monitor (TVMM) 是另一种虚拟机监视器,它是为教育和验证目的而开发的
- thready:Nim中线程的备用接口
- ECGmatematica.mat,交通标志识别MATLAB源码,matlab源码怎么用
- Count misc prices-crx插件
- WORKDAYnode.js
- apps-para-treinar-[removed]列表应用程序JavaScript